Latest Patents:

Meyer's latest patents revolve around two innovative areas: functionalized polymers and cross-linked polyglycerol esters. His work on functionalized polymers encompasses a broad range of applications, with a particular emphasis on personal care. These functionalized polymers offer improved properties in products such as cosmetics, lotions, and hair care formulations. The patents highlight both the process for producing these polymers and their diverse uses.

One of Meyer's noteworthy recent inventions is the development of cross-linked polyglycerol esters. This innovation involves the esterification of polyglycerol with a mixture of carboxylic acids, resulting in a novel compound with unique properties. These cross-linked polyglycerol esters have found applications as water-in-oil (W/O) emulsifiers, improving stability and texture in various personal care products.
